Output 3f6a25626bddf5d006661b5c20f5f8ca6cf112ff9f1b232c930a0df05043b949:13

value
27516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f15bab6354b143a70c802688c8a8e02b357e0d4 OP_EQUAL
address
35yyiLjLUraLD6DezZkvZT2kHBtjRCjarK
transaction
3f6a25626bddf5d006661b5c20f5f8ca6cf112ff9f1b232c930a0df05043b949
spent
true